China Begins Building the World’s Largest Hydropower Dam in Tibet
China’s Premier Li Qiang announced the commencement of construction on what will be the world’s largest hydropower dam. The project, situated on the eastern edge of the Tibetan plateau, is estimated to cost approximately $170 billion, according to Xinhua news agency. Malaysia Mandates Trade Permit for Import of U.S.-Origin AI Chips
Malaysia’s Ministry of Investment, Trade and Industry announced on Monday that, effective immediately, the export, transhipment, and transit of high-performance artificial intelligence (AI) chips originating from the United States will require prior approval through a trade permit. Wikipedia Takes India’s Takedown Order to Supreme Court
The Wikimedia Foundation, which runs Wikipedia, has taken its fight for free speech to India’s Supreme Court. It is challenging an order that requires the online encyclopedia to remove a page discussing its legal battle with Indian news agency ANI.
